QuickTest Professional (QTP) First Steps Windows Course

Course Code: MQ 547
Course Abstract: This core course provides comprehensive understanding of QTP as a functional automated testing tool for different windows environments.  The course covers the use of QTP’s graphical point and click interface to record and run tests, to add synchronization points and verification steps, and to create tests with multiple actions.  The course delves into test objects, how QTP identifies them, how to use and manage the object repository and spy.  The participant will build on fundamental topics by using debugging tools to troubleshoot tests.  Additional checkpoints and product options will be used to broaden the scope of business processes that can be automated.
Once tests are created, the participant will discover and correct common record and run problems.

Note: All topics are supported by hands-on exercises based on real-life examples.
Audience: This course is designed for individuals who are new users who need to automate manual tests and verifications in a short amount of time. The course covers Windows Forms testing.
Duration: 3 days
Learning Outcomes:

Upon completion of this course, the participant will be able to:
